About the Author

Prof. Krishna Roy has more than 35 years of professional experience which includes 6 years in Systems Analysis and Software Development and 3 decades in teaching Computer Science, Management Science, Operations Management, Quantitative Techniques, Entrepreneurship, Business Communication and Soft skills. She completed her MBA from the Indian Institute of Social Welfare and Business Management in 1988. She started her career with the multinational, GEC of (I) Ltd and later shifted to academics. Her research area includes digital marketing, marketing analytics and marketing research. She is a senior member of the Operational Research Society of India and the current Vice President of its Durgapur Chapter. She has been teaching MBA students at the Faculty of Management Studies, Dr. B. C. Roy Engineering College, Durgapur, West Bengal, India since 2005.
 
Prof. Arunava Mookherjee earned her PhD in CRM and Customer Analytics and is dedicated to teaching MBA students for the last 2 decades at the Faculty of Management Studies, Dr. B.C Roy Engineering College, Durgapur, West Bengal, India. Prior to joining academics she had a brief stint with CRM research and analytics in the Banking and Finance sector. 
An alumnus of the Centre for Management Studies, the University of Burdwan and the Department of Physics, BHU she specializes in Customer Data Analytics and CRM modelling. She has a keen interest in Digital and Social Media analytics and its applications in Strategic Integrated Marketing Communications.

Prof. Niloy Kumar Bhattacherjee teaches MBA students in the marketing area at the Faculty of Management Studies, Dr. B. C. Roy Engineering College, Durgapur, West Bengal, India. Before joining academics, he worked in the marketing research industry for half a decade. An alumnus of IIFM, Bhopal (PGP) and BHU, Varanasi (Economics), Prof. Bhattacherjee specializes in marketing research and stochastic modelling and data science applications in marketing management. He has keen research interest in stochastic modelling, machine learning, data science and analytics for marketing research and allied areas.
